Programming/Editing Memory Dial Buttons

This feature allows you to program or edit numbers in the three memory locations (M1-M3)
or make changes to the currently programmed numbers .
To program the memory keys:
1 . Press the MENU button, then press the DOWN arrow to the "View MemDial?"
screen . (See Figure 12) You will have the option of choosing "Yes" or "No" . Select
"Yes" by pressing the One (1) button.
2 . "MemDial 1" or the saved name and number will be displayed . (To go to the next
MemDial location, press the DOWN arrow) .
3 . Use the DEL button to delete the text "MemDial 1" or name stored . Next, type in
the name of the record you wish to store, then press ENTER .
4 . Use the DEL button to delete the number to be edited . If there is no number stored,
enter the telephone number you wish to store (up to 31 digits), then press ENTER . The
number is now stored into the M1 button, then the screen advances to the next memo-
ry location (M2) .
5 . Repeat the steps to program M2 .
To edit the memory keys: repeat the programming sequence again .
NOTE: programming a location overwrites the previously saved number at that location .
To enter a space, press "1" .
